Installation involves removing the old roof, inspecting and preparing the deck, applying underlayment, and then securely fastening the steel panels. Proper ventilation is crucial for Colorado's temperature extremes. Our process ensures a robust, weather-tight installation.

The 25% rule suggests that if a quarter or more of a roof needs repair, it's often more economical to replace the entire roof. This ensures a uniform, high-performance system for Colorado homes, preventing future issues.
